The Houston Texans are 6-3, yes, and just lost to a very bad New York Jets team, but you can't tell me that when this team is healthy they aren't one of the best in the entire NFL. But, because healthy seems to be a big ask these days, especially on the offensive side of the ball.

The defensive side of the ball is still feasting. Will Anderson is still being Will Anderson, getting to the QB and disrupting things. And across from him, Danielle Hunter looks to be one of the best pass rushers in the entire NFL, as he leads the league in pressures with 54, and the next highest having just six less in Myles Garrett.

But the offensive side has been struggling. They can't seem to protect quarterback C.J. Stroud at all, and the receivers they do have available aren't giving him much help. There's really no fixing the offensive line, but getting a guy like Nico Collins back could do wonders.

And, they will be getting reinforcements soon. But, they aren't the reinforcements they necessarily need the most. They need some injured guys on offense to come back. Instead, they're getting some guys back on the defensive side of the ball.

According to the Texans, defensive end Jerry Hughes and cornerback Jeff Okudah have returned to practice and been Designated for Return.

This does help the defense, who's still been great, but man, they could really use some help on the offensive side of the ball.

The Texans play the Detroit Lions on Sunday Night Football this upcoming week, and then they play on Monday Night Football against the Dallas Cowboys.
